An unusual portrait of Alexander I Balas
Lot 1026
SELEUKID KINGS OF SYRIA. Alexander I Balas, 152-145 BC. Drachm (Silver, 17 mm, 3.40 g, 12 h), uncertain mint in the East. Diademed head of Alexander I to right. Rev. [BA]ΣIΛEΩ[Σ] / [A]ΛEΞANΔ[POY] - ΘΕΟΠΑΤΟΡΟΣ / [ΕΥ]ΕΡΓΕΤΟΥ Apollo seated left on omphalos, holding arrow in his right hand and resting his left on grounded bow; in exergue, uncertain monograms. SC -. An interesting issue with a very unusual portrait. Struck on a slightly short flan and with a flan crack, otherwise, good very fine.

Privately acquired from Pars Coins at New York International Numismatic Convention on 10 January 2023.

The peculiar style of the king's portrait and the rather sloppy execution of the letters on the reverse strongly indicate that this coin was produced at an uncertain eastern mint.
